Loading... 将session里的json字符串转换为数组 //a:3:{s:4:"name";s:6:"huqian";s:3:"sex";s:3:"男";s:3:"age";i:27;} $whereSql = json_decode(getSession('whereSql')); $whereSql['name']; 出现错误: Cannot use object of type stdClass as array 解决方法(2种): 1、使用 json_decode($d, true)。就是使json_decode 的第二个变量设置为 true,转换为数组 2、json_decode($res) 返回的是一个对象, 不可以使用 $res['key'] 进行访问, 换成 $res->key 就可以了 相关文章 代码测试 php检查URL是否有效 PHP date() 函数可实现的功能列表 phpgrace 定义json返回数据 phpGrace 自带分页参数代码 PHP检测Emoji过滤Emoji PHP对HTML标签转义及反转义 PHP爬虫工具phpquery中文手册 PHP爬虫采集工具phpQuery的用法 发现phpGrace工具实例化函数bug一枚 Last modification:May 5th, 2020 at 09:05 pm © 允许规范转载 Support 如果觉得我的文章对你有用,请随意赞赏 ×Close Appreciate the author Sweeping payments Pay by AliPay Pay by WeChat